Kennisbank

1.000 veelgestelde vragen, 500 tutorials en uitlegvideo's. Hier vind je alleen maar oplossingen!

Toon de inhoud van een map zonder index

Deze handleiding legt de directive "Options +Indexes" uit voor webhosting, wat de navigatie voor bezoekers vergemakkelijkt en een gedetailleerdere aanpassing mogelijk maakt van de manier waarop bestanden worden weergegeven.

 

Inleiding

  • Een van de belangrijkste voordelen van het activeren van de directory-indexering is dat bezoekers alle bestanden en submappen van een bepaalde map kunnen bekijken en weergeven, zelfs als ze de exacte bestandsnaam niet kennen waarnaar ze op zoek zijn. Dit kan vooral handig zijn voor bestandsdelingssites of downloadpagina's.
  • Directory-indexering vergemakkelijkt ook de navigatie voor bezoekers die niet bekend zijn met de bestandsstructuur van de website. Ze kunnen eenvoudig door de submappen navigeren om het bestand of de map te vinden die ze nodig hebben.
  • De directive "Options +Indexes" kan worden aangepast om extra informatie weer te geven, zoals de grootte en de wijzigingsdatum van de bestanden, of om bepaalde bestanden of mappen te verbergen.
  • Zonder deze directive kan een bezoeker een foutmelding krijgen:
Accès interdit!
Vous n'avez pas le droit d'accéder au répertoire demandé.
Soit il n'y a pas de document index soit le répertoire est protégé.
Si vous pensez qu'il s'agit d'une erreur du serveur, veuillez contacter le gestionnaire du site.
Error 403

 

De inhoud van een webmap weergeven

Om de elementen in een map weer te geven zonder een speciale index:

  1. Maak een .htaccess-bestand in de betreffende map.
  2. Voer de volgende opdracht in: Options +Indexes

Het is belangrijk om te weten dat deze oplossing alleen werkt als er geen index in de betreffende map aanwezig is; u moet de bestanden index.php, index.html, index.htm, enz. en eventueel het bestand welcome.php verwijderen.

 

Aanpassen van de weergave

Hieronder staat een voorbeeldcode om het uiterlijk van de door Apache gegenereerde bestandslijst aan te passen:

Options +Indexes
IndexOptions FancyIndexing
IndexOptions FoldersFirst IgnoreCase NameWidth=* DescriptionWidth=* Charset=UTF-8
HeaderName header.html
ReadmeName footer.html

In dit voorbeeld activeert de gebruiker de optie "Indexes", voegt de optie "FancyIndexing" toe voor een aantrekkelijker uiterlijk, geeft de sorteervolgorde van de bestanden op, definieert de kolombreedte voor de naam en de beschrijving van de bestanden en geeft de namen van de bestanden op die gebruikt moeten worden voor de kop- en voettekst van de bestandslijst.

Link naar deze veelgestelde vragen: https://faq.infomaniak.com/147


Is deze veelgestelde vragenlijst nuttig geweest?